Before You Announce Your New Email Address
Before sending out notifications, make sure you have:
- Set up your new email account and tested its functionality
- Updated your email address on all relevant platforms and accounts
- Prepared a clear and concise message to share with your contacts
Best Practices for Announcing a New Email Address
When it comes to announcing your new email address, timing and approach are everything. Here are some best practices for announcing a new email address to consider:
1. Notify Your Contacts in Advance
Give your contacts sufficient notice before switching to your new email address. This allows them to update their records and avoid any confusion. Consider sending a notification 2-4 weeks before the change.
Example:
Dear valued clients,
As part of our ongoing effort to improve our services, we will be updating our email addresses. Our new email address will be newemail@example.com, effective [Date]. Please update your records accordingly.
2. Use Clear and Concise Language
When announcing your new email address, use simple and straightforward language to avoid confusion. Make sure to include:
- Your old email address
- Your new email address
- The date of the change
3. Provide an Update on Your Email Services
If you’re changing your email address due to a change in email service providers or settings, consider providing an update on what this means for your contacts.
Example:
We are upgrading our email services to improve security and functionality. As part of this change, our email addresses will be updated to newemail@example.com. This change will not affect your ability to reach us, but you may need to update your records.

Tips for Writing an Effective Announcement
When writing your announcement, keep the following tips in mind:
| Tip | Description |
|---|---|
| 1. Keep it short and sweet | Keep your announcement brief and to the point |
| 2. Use a clear subject line | Use a clear and descriptive subject line to grab attention |
| 3. Include a call-to-action | Encourage your contacts to update their records or take action |
Communicating Your New Email Address to Colleagues and Clients
When communicating your new email address to colleagues and clients, consider the following:
- Send a company-wide email or announcement
- Update your email signature to reflect your new email address
- Notify your clients or customers directly, if necessary

Measuring the Success of Your Announcement
To measure the success of your announcement, consider tracking:
- Open rates and click-through rates
- Responses or replies to your announcement
- Updates to your contact information
Common Mistakes to Avoid When Announcing Your New Email Address
When announcing your new email address, avoid the following common mistakes:
- Not providing sufficient notice
- Using unclear or confusing language
- Not updating all relevant platforms and accounts
